File IO¶

In [1]:
!type data.txt
Hello, world!
I like Python.
In [2]:
[s for s in open('data.txt',encoding='utf-8')]
Out[2]:
['Hello, world!\n', 'I like Python.\n']
In [3]:
f=open('outdata.txt','w')

for i in range(10):
    f.write(f'This is line {i}\n')

f.close()
In [4]:
!type outdata.txt
This is line 0
This is line 1
This is line 2
This is line 3
This is line 4
This is line 5
This is line 6
This is line 7
This is line 8
This is line 9
In [5]:
for s in open('outdata.txt'):
    print(s)
This is line 0

This is line 1

This is line 2

This is line 3

This is line 4

This is line 5

This is line 6

This is line 7

This is line 8

This is line 9